What soil is best for azaleas?

1. Specific requirements

Looseness and good ventilation: These two aspects are similar. If they meet the requirements, the breathing of the plant will not be too hindered, which can promote its rapid growth.

Rich in humus: This is in terms of the amount of nutrition. More nutrients will provide sufficient supply for its growth and then for its flowering. Moreover, the benefits are not limited to this one aspect. On the other hand, it can also improve the structure of the soil, making it more water- and fertilizer-retaining.

Slightly acidic: In terms of pH, we should choose acidic soil. If the soil you choose is alkaline, the leaves of the plant will turn yellow and may even die. However, it does not need to be too acidic, a slightly acidic pH value of 5.5 to 6.5 is enough.

2. What kind of soil should be used?

Generally speaking, leaf mold is better. First of all, it is a typical acidic soil. In addition, it can basically meet the above requirements. Among all leaf molds, pine leaf humus has the best effect. We can dig it from under the pine trees in the woods, or we can take it from the courtyard where there are many pine and cypress trees. Of course, there is more than one method available. There are many other soils available, such as nutrient soil from flower shops, pond mud, etc.

3. Notes

① You should avoid choosing soils that are particularly sticky, such as red soil. This type of soil is not suitable for plant growth.

②In order to ensure the subsequent nutrient supply, you can add an appropriate amount of base fertilizer to the soil.

③If the water permeability is not very good, you can add some coal slag.
